How do get around the Dominican Republic?

Introduction

The Dominican Republic is a dream destination for millions of travelers every year. With white sandy beaches, turquoise waters, and authentic villages, there are a thousand things to discover. But one question always comes up for visitors: how can you get around easily and safely once you’re there?
There are a variety of options, ranging from comfortable taxis to local buses, but not all are equal in terms of safety, convenience, and comfort. This article will guide you in making the best choice by sharing the advantages and disadvantages of each mode of transportation, so that your stay is relaxing and stress-free.

Taxis: the safest and most comfortable option

Of all the options available, taxis remain by far the safest, most convenient, and most comfortable means of transportation in the Dominican Republic.
They are easy to find in all major cities, tourist areas, airports, and even near popular beaches.

Why choose a taxi?
Increased safety: drivers are familiar with the roads, local driving habits, and areas to avoid.
Guaranteed comfort: air-conditioned vehicles, direct routes, and no unexpected stops.
Convenience: no stress related to parking or navigation.

In the Dominican Republic, it is common for taxis not to have meters. It is therefore important to ask the price before getting in. In some cities, apps such as Uber or InDrive offer fare transparency and allow you to avoid negotiations.

If your priority is peace of mind and safety, especially if you are traveling with children or luggage, a taxi is undoubtedly the best choice. Car rental: an option to avoid for most travelers

 
Renting a car may seem attractive for exploring the island at your own pace, but it is not an option we recommend, and here’s why:
• Very different traffic laws: rules are rarely followed and driving is often unpredictable.
• Road safety: dangerous overtaking, heavy traffic in urban areas, and motorcycles everywhere on the roads.
• Variable infrastructure: some secondary roads are in poor condition and poorly signposted.
 
If you still want to rent a car:
Choose a sturdy vehicle, ideally an SUV.
• Take out comprehensive insurance.
• Avoid driving at night.
 
In summary, unless you already have solid experience driving in Latin America or similar environments, it is better to choose other, safer means of transportation.

Intercity buses: economical and comfortable for long journeys

Intercity buses are a reliable and economical option for traveling between major cities or certain tourist areas. Different companies offer regular and comfortable routes.
 
Advantages:
• Very affordable prices.
• Air conditioning and reserved seats.
•    Fixed schedules and reasonable punctuality.
 
Disadvantages:
•    Less flexibility than a taxi.
•    Dependence on scheduled routes and timetables.
 
If you are traveling light and want to save money, the bus is a safe and pleasant alternative, provided you are willing to share the space with other passengers.

Guaguas: immersion in local life but limited comfort

Guaguas are local minibuses that serve almost all towns and villages. Their biggest advantage is their price: they are by far the cheapest option.
 
However, you should be aware that:
• Departures are not always on time (they usually leave when the vehicle is full).
•    Comfort is basic, with no air conditioning and frequent stops.
    They are often crowded, which can be tiring, especially on long journeys.
 
It’s an experience worth trying to immerse yourself in everyday Dominican life, but it’s not the best mode of transport for a relaxing and safe trip.

Motoconchos and conchos: for very short journeys

In small towns and villages, motoconchos (motorcycle taxis) and conchos (shared taxis) are everywhere.
•    Motoconchos are fast and very affordable, but pose a safety risk, especially without a helmet.
•    Conchos follow a fixed route and take several passengers at a time, making them economical but less comfortable.
 
These options are purely local and can be useful for very short trips, but are not ideal for visitors seeking comfort and safety.

Conclusion

In the Dominican Republic, there are several modes of transportation available, but not all are equal.
If your priority is safety, comfort, and peace of mind, taxis remain the best option, especially for trips to and from the airport or for traveling between your hotel and tourist attractions.
Car rental is not recommended due to very different and sometimes chaotic traffic laws. Intercity buses and guaguas offer an economical but less flexible alternative. Motoconchos and conchos are more suitable for very short trips and travelers who are used to local transportation.
